Calorie calculator. use the calorie calculator to estimate the number of daily calories your body needs to maintain your current weight. if you're pregnant or breast feeding, are a competitive athlete, or have a metabolic disease, such as diabetes, the calorie calculator may overestimate or underestimate your actual calorie needs. For the average individual, it takes roughly 1,320 calories to support your liver, brain, heart, and kidneys each day this amount falls below many of the popular weight loss diet plans that recommend 1,200 calorie diets (2, 3). majority of these calorie needs come from your heart and kidneys, requiring about 440 calories per day each. For example, if your target calorie intake is 14,000 calories per week, you could consume 2,300 calories three days a week, and 1,775 the other four days of the week, or you could consume 2,000 calories each day. in both cases, 14,000 calories would be consumed over the week, but the body wouldn't adapt and compensate for a 2,000 calorie diet.
